创建浏览器堆栈

描述

端点“创建浏览器堆栈”用于创建 环境 上班族中的浏览器堆栈类型。 成功创建浏览器堆栈环境后,将返回该环境的ID作为响应。

创建的环境的详细信息可以通过以下方式进行验证:  通过ID获取环境 端点。

要求网址

http:// {controllerMachine}:{controllerPort} / api / v3 / 环境s / create / browserstack

输入参数

属性 类型 描述 评论
requestBody 应用程序/ json

浏览器堆栈环境的唯一标识符,包括以下参数:

  • IsWebLocal
  • 标题
  • 描述
  • 用户名
  • 快捷键
  • LocalIdentifier
  • OSType
  • 操作系统版本
  • 浏览器
  • 浏览器版本

请参阅文档以获取 环境环境 有关用法的更多详细信息。

 

例子

卷曲


curl -X PUT-标头'Accept:application / json'-标头'AccessKey:Mo87Nc4qDAtzJNDb' -d'{\
“标题”:“我的远程代理环境”,\
“描述”:“远程代理”,\
“ 用户名”:“ LeapworkUser”,\
“ 快捷键”:“密码”,\
“ OSType”:“ Windows”,\
“ 操作系统版本”:“ 10”,\
“浏览器”:“ Chrome”,\
“ 浏览器版本”:“最新”,\
“ LocalIdentifier”:“本地”,\
“ IsWebLocal”:“ true”

}' 'http://{controllerMachine}:{controllerPort} / api / v3 / enviroments / create / browserstack'

电源外壳 

$ headers = @ {}
$ headers.Add(“ 快捷键”,“ Mo87Nc4qDAtzJNDb”)

$ requestBody = @'
{
   “标题”:“我的远程代理环境”,
   “描述”:“远程代理”,
   “ 用户名”:“ LeapworkUser”,
   “ 快捷键”:“密码”,
   
“ OSType”:“ Windows”,
    "操作系统版本": "10",
   “浏览器”:“ Chrome”,
   “ 浏览器版本”:“最新”,
   “ LocalIdentifier”:“本地”,
   “ IsWebLocal”:“ true”

}
'@ 

Invoke-WebRequest -Uri“ http://{controllerMachine}:{controllerPort}/ api / v3 /环境/创建/浏览器堆栈“ -ContentType” application / json“-标题$ headers-方法PUT  -Body $requestBody

反应体

CreateEnvironmentResponse 目的:

{

  "$ id": "1",

  "环境Id“:”4d9c09fe-7ced-4494-8841-378491ebc899"

}

 

响应对象

领域 类型 描述 价值观
$ id 内部项目的标识(文件夹/流程/元素等)  
环境Id 创建的环境的ID  


回应码

200(确定)

404(未找到)

401(错误的访问密钥)

400(错误请求,找不到资产)

500内部服务器错误)